Martha P. Vatterott, RD, LD
Martha Vatterott is a registered clinical Dietitian. She received her B.S. in Medical Dietetics from the University of Missouri-Columbia, 1980 and has been registered with The American Dietetic Association since 1980. Martha is a licensed Dietitian with the State of Missouri. Through licensure (2001), registered Dietitians are the only nutrition professionals qualified to practice nutrition counseling. She has recently acquired the certification of Adult Weight Management through the American Dietetic Association. Martha has been counseling clients with a variety of modified diets for 25 years.
Counseling sessions include a nutrition history, assessment and nutrition education. Each diet is individualized to the client's food preferences and lifestyle to promote compliance.
The Medifast Diet Plan, a medically supervised protein sparing modified fast is also available. Clients must be medically supervised. The Plan consists of five Medifast meals per day and one evening meal of meat and vegetables. A weight loss of about five pounds per week is average. The Plan can be followed for up to 16 weeks. Weekly or bi-weekly visits with Martha will cover Nutrition Education and Behavior Modification. Her goal is to teach clients how to eat for the rest of their life. A "Lifestyles" book through Medifast is required ($12). After desired weight loss is achieved, clients will be "transitioned" back to real food.
